Haleakalā

A visit to the volcano is safe, fun and breathtaking. Allow 2.5 hours each way, and take warm clothes as it's cold up there! If you want to see the sunrise, you MUST book on the national parks website in advance, although space for sunset is pretty easy. The Apollo moon landings were practiced up here, and from the summit you can see the hawaiian island chain! A must do!

Lahaina

Lahaina is the ancient royal capital of Hawaii, and the historic center of the world's whaling industry. Now a living, breathing museum of stunning historic houses and home to amazing shopping, including galleries, boutiques & restaurants. Allow 30-45 minutes to drive there., and plan an afternoon.

Cráter Molokini

There are several operators to the Molokini crater that operate all year round. This is a great morning out, usually includes Lunch on the Boat. You’re practically guaranteed to see some form of marine life (such as whales, turtles, dolphins & fish) all year round, with whale sightings likely in January-March. This is still a great excursion if you choose not to get in the water.

Cascada Twin Falls Maui

North of the small town of Paia and on the road to Hana. Pull up at the carpark on the side of the road, grab a fresh coconut and take a light hike through the forest to several beautiful waterfall cascades. The Flora & Fauna on this hike are amazing!. Take care if you decide to swim, and be aware that some of waterfall areas require a climb down from the path.

Hana Highway

a drive of outstanding natural beauty, as the road winds all the way to the village of Hana at the south east end of Maui. This is a whole day drive, so plan for an early start, and lots and lots of sharp turns and hairpin bends. Grab a waterfall guide for the drive as there are numerous places to stop. You can refuel and stay overnight in Hana. The motto that best describes this experience is “it’s about the journey more than the destination”.
